A history of popular trends in the history of cinema, sorted by decade. To be clear, these are not the BEST or most well REGARDED films of each decade, or even which ones stood the test of time or became classics. Many of those weren't even popular or well known back in their respective decades or years of release, and only became well known years later.

Rather, these are the ones that were actually the MOST POPULAR OR HYPED films back when they originally came out... even if no one still talks about them today. Hence many of these titles faded into total obscurity, and are completely unknown outside of the original generation of audience members who saw them.
